It sounds like you're wondering about opening links in another application and if you can choose which tab group in Safari it opens in. We're glad you've joined us in Apple Support Communities. Let's see if this helps.
Depending on the application, you can hold down the Control button on your keyboard and click on the link, and you may get the option to "Open link in Tab Group." You can then pick that option and then pick the tab group you want the link to open in. You can test out this feature in Safari to see how it works.
If you don't see the option outlined above for the application you're working in, then that app developer does not offer that option. In that case, you'll want to reach out to them for more assistance using the steps in How to contact an app developer.
Another alternative is to open the link how it normally opens (in the wrong tab group) and then Control + Click on the tab title itself in Safari. There you will see an option to "Move Tab Group" and then you can move the window to the correct group. You can also drag the tab to the correct group as outlined in the section "Open a tab in another window" in Use tabs for webpages in Safari on Mac.
